The Town Board Meeting of Huntersville, NC, held on September 15, 2026, included several procurement-related discussions primarily focused on property acquisition and capital improvement projects. The board considered and unanimously approved a purchase agreement for approximately 0.963 acres located at 14725 North Old Statesville Road, intended for park expansion as part of the Holbrook Park capital improvement plan. The property was appraised at $880,000, and the purchase price was $840,000, with plans to seek grant funding from the Land and Water Conservation Fund (LWCF) and PARTIF to potentially reimburse the town. Additionally, the board discussed an ongoing property acquisition negotiation for a parcel at 107 North Maxwell, with offers and counteroffers between $450,000 and $795,000. The meeting also included the adoption of an ordinance regulating electric-assisted bicycles, aligning local law with recent state statutes, which may impact future enforcement and public safety policies. Other topics included updates on the Greenway Trail and Bike Way Committee projects and community grant programs, but no other direct procurement actions were taken.
